To live a long healthy life, food plays a main role. We know that fast-food and too much sugar are bad for us, and lean protein and vegetables are ideal.
But there’s one food item that can actually reduce mortality – whole grains.
Although bleached and white breads are not good for us, whole grains on the other hand offer us many nutritional benefits. Whole grains contain all the essential nutrients from the grain and have undergone little to no processing.
When foods go through processing and refining, many of the nutritional benefits become lost or devalued, so keeping the grain intact is essential for good health. In fact, a single serving of whole grains can help lower your risk of dying – of cardiovascular disease in particular – by up to 10 percent. That’s according to new research published in the Journal of the American Medical Association (JAMA).
